Output b89e379929787f4dc135cace95742e89f26b27110bf16d623df11e35f8d7a1ac:1

value
2825407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ba0fc56e72dc1956ea06a6bcf3a0deb6de20c89 OP_EQUAL
address
3BW75YytiG4DT3fqgwaaGaqmQTPMcCrMQV
transaction
b89e379929787f4dc135cace95742e89f26b27110bf16d623df11e35f8d7a1ac
confirmations
424435
spent
true